You can test the cluster by running Hue. 
        
            Hue is a graphical user interface that allows you to interact with your clusters by
                running applications that let you browse HDFS and cloud object storage such as S3
                and ABFS, manage a Hive metastore, and run Hive, Impala, and Search queries, and
                Oozie workflows.

                By default, Authentication Backend is set to
                        AllowFirstUserDjangoBackend. This makes the first
                    user who logs into Hue the Superuser and allows you to set the username and
                    password, and create other users. You can change the Authentication Backend as per your
                    requirements from Hue configurations in Cloudera Manager.
